| Portal Member | Hi everyone, I was trying to watch what I was recording the other day and I had a hard time getting it to work... Before I begin here's my config: Asus M2N-E AMD X2 4400+ 4GB Ram Vista 32bits ATI HD2600XT 512 DDR3 80gb HD TwinHan VisionPlus 1020a D-Link Wireless card Single seat configuration My Tv wasn't open, so I opened it. I normally select the option to turn tv on automatically so I got the error saying can't start timeshifting for channel 123 because card is busy or something... That's not a problem, I know I'm recording a show, so I'll just try to connect to the stream and watch it as it's recorded. I go into stream select the stream and then I wait and wait and wait... Then after 5 minutes of waiting I decide to close mediaportal. That's when I saw that mediaportal wasn't responding, so I kill the task. Is this normal behaior? The only way I could connect to the stream was to go in the guide and then select the same channel I was recording. I was trying to figure out why isn't there a function that when MP is trying to start the tv when tv server is recording, it doesn't switch to the channel that's being recorded. Does anyone know why?
